The Details of the Price Increase
Effective immediately, the PlayStation 5 and its digital version have both seen their prices rise to $499.99 and $399.99, respectively. This marks the second time in less than a year that Sony has upped the price tag on its flagship gaming console, signaling turbulent times ahead for both the manufacturer and its dedicated fan base. Factors Behind the Price Surge
Several key factors seem to have influenced Sony’s decision to raise prices yet again. The ongoing global economic pressures play a significant role, with inflationary trends affecting supply chains and manufacturing costs. From rising costs in materials to increased logistics expenses due to international shipping constraints, various economic pressures have hit technology manufacturers hard in recent years.
Moreover, competition in the gaming market is fierce. With rivals like Microsoft and their Xbox Series X and S consoles offering enticing options, Sony faces the challenge of balancing quality and affordability, all while striving to maintain market leadership.
